Fmoc-D-Lys(Biotin)-OH is a key reagent widely utilized in chemical synthesis for the modification and functionalization of peptides and proteins. This compound, consisting of a biotin moiety linked to a lysine amino acid derivative protected with the Fmoc group, offers a versatile tool for the site-specific incorporation of biotin tags into biomolecules.In peptide synthesis, Fmoc-D-Lys(Biotin)-OH acts as a valuable building block for the generation of biotinylated peptides with precise control over the positioning of the biotin moiety. This enables the selective attachment of streptavidin or avidin-linked molecules for various applications in biological research, such as affinity purification, protein-protein interaction studies, and immunoassays.Furthermore, the Fmoc protecting group allows for orthogonal deprotection in solid-phase peptide synthesis, facilitating efficient and high-yielding peptide modifications. By strategically incorporating Fmoc-D-Lys(Biotin)-OH into peptide sequences, researchers can introduce biotin tags at specific sites within a peptide chain, offering a tailored approach to functionalizing peptides for diverse biotechnological and biochemical applications.
